Search Tab FAQ

1) Can I use a search tab on a site that includes frames?

Maybe. Make sure you leave enough space on the edge where the tab will be shown to accommodate it. Otherwise it might obscure your content.

2) When I click on the search tab, it opens under items already on my page. What can I do?

We make very effort to identify the highest zIndex in use on your page, but sometimes we are not able to do this effectively. Check to see if you've hard-coded a zIndex anywhere.

6) There are no search results! What's wrong?

Make sure you have associated the correct site url with the search tool you're using. If you want to search multiple domains like http://A.site.com/ and http://B.site.com/ you'll need to use http://site.com/. Using just a subdomain like A.site.com will not search WWW.site.com.
